Hi,
Recently I thought I'd like to have sdl apps running directly on the framebuffer to save memory being used by qt. I compiled latest libsdl using --enable-fbcon, compiled at test program with that lib, and launched it in console mode in my sharp rom. (console mode can be accessed by modifying /root/etc/rc.d/rc.rofilesys: on the last line, replace "$LAUNCH" by "a"). So, logged in as root, I tried to launch my test program, but get the following error: "Couldn't set a 640x480 video mode: No video mode large enough for 640x480" Questions: - is it a reasonable idea to have sdl in framebuffer? - how to resolve the error?
